Score 93/100 · Drink 2025-2060, William Kelley, Wine Advocate, Jan 2022
The 2019 Meursault Les Petits Charrons unwinds in the glass with notions of white flowers, orange oil, freshly baked bread, buttered popcorn and nashi pear. Medium to full-bodied, dainty and precise, it's bright and vibrant, with beautiful purity of fruit and a long, mouthwatering finish. It's the most ethereal Meursault in the range.

Score 17/20 · Drink 2023-2030, Jancis Robinson MW, Oct 2020
This parcel is between Les Grands Charrons and Les Chevalières lieux-dits and under Les Rougeots. Four barrels, one new. Tank sample. Light smoke and golden ripe apples on the nose. Very juicy and salivatory. Powerful finish. Very neat and pleasing and relatively forward. (JR)
